Learning Outcomes
Upon successful completion of this course, the student will be able to:
- Present a compelling delivery of any message, written or improvised; conversation or formal presentations.
- Influence and inspire any audience with your desired outcome.
- Improve the meaning behind your chosen words using subtexts.
- Assess whether you have captured and maintained the attention of the audience.
- Improve presentation abilities through acting tricks and improvisation.
- Elevate your personal voice to become your most powerful tool.
- Successfully interpret direction/directing words to refine delivery.
- Apply different vocal techniques and exercises to speak in front of any audience with ease
